Skip to content

Commit

Permalink
Merge pull request #51247 from curstwist/more-minor-adjustments
Browse files Browse the repository at this point in the history
more minor map adjustments
  • Loading branch information
Rivet-the-Zombie authored Aug 31, 2021
2 parents 91ab3fc + c16998a commit 0447a46
Show file tree
Hide file tree
Showing 5 changed files with 49 additions and 44 deletions.
34 changes: 18 additions & 16 deletions data/json/mapgen/lab/lab_modular/lab_1x1_security.json
Original file line number Diff line number Diff line change
Expand Up @@ -60,35 +60,34 @@
"method": "json",
"om_terrain": [ "lab_security_z0" ],
"type": "mapgen",
"//": "TODO: trap the security hallway, fill out security area",
"weight": 200,
"object": {
"fill_ter": "t_linoleum_white",
"rows": [
"|||+||+||||||||||||==|||",
"|||+||+||||||||||||==ƶ||",
"|34.|P.P..+..h.|;;;;;;;;",
"X...|....h|III6:;;;;;;è;",
"XH..:J..II|::::|;;||||||",
"XH..:Jh...=;;;;;;;=;|PPT",
"XH..:J..II|::::|;;|#||||",
"XH..:Jh...=;;;;;;;|;|PPT",
"-...:J..II|;è;;;;ɜ|;:.h.",
"XH..|Y..h.|;;;|||||;:.rr",
"XH..||:||||;;;|;;;|è|h.h",
"XH..=..ɛ|.|;;;|;è;+;||+|",
"|y..¥...|.|;è;|;;;|;;;;;",
"|||||..||||;;;|||||||;;;",
"|>ë.|..122|;;;+;Z|>;ƶ;;i",
"|...-..-22|;;;|WW|>;=;èi",
"|>ë.:..122|;;;+;Z|>;ƶ;;i",
"|...#..-22|;;;|WW|>;=;èi",
"|||||..||||;;;|||||||;;;",
"|y..¥...|.|;è;|;;;|;;;;;",
"XH..=..ɛ|.|;;;|;è;+;||+|",
"XH..||:||||;;;|;;;|è|h.h",
"XH..|Y...h|;;;|||||;:.rr",
"-...:J..II|;è;;;;ɜ|;:.h.",
"XH..:Jh...=;;;;;;;=;|yPP;",
"XH..:J..II|::::|;;||||||",
"XH..:Jh...=;;;;;;;|;|yPP;",
"XH..:J..II|::::|;;|#||||",
"X...|...h.|III6:;;;;;;è;",
"|34.|P.P..+..h.|;;;;;;;;",
"|||+||+||||||||||||==|||"
"|||+||+||||||||||||==ƶ||"
],
"palettes": [ "lab_common_palette", "lab_security_palette" ],
"terrain": {
Expand Down Expand Up @@ -244,14 +243,14 @@
"object": {
"fill_ter": "t_thconc_floor",
"rows": [
"|,,,,,,,,,ƶ`````|⁴⁴⁴⁴⁴⁴",
"|,,,,,,,,,ƶ`````|⁴⁴⁴⁴⁴⁴é",
"|,,,,,,,,,=``î`<|⁴⁴⁴⁴⁴⁴⁴",
"|,,,,,,,,,|`````|⁴⁴%%%%",
"|,,,,,,,,,|`````|é⁴⁴%%%%",
"|,,,,,,,,,|``|#||⁴⁴%%~~~",
"|,,,,,,,,,|``|>|⁴⁴%%~~~~",
"|,,,,ê,,,,|ƶ=|||⁴%%~~~~~",
"|,,,,,,,,,|⁴⁴⁴⁴⁴%%~~~~~~",
"|,,,,,,,,,|⁴⁴⁴%%~~~~~~~",
"|,,,,,,,,,|⁴é⁴⁴%%~~~~~~~",
"|,,,,,,,,,|⁴⁴⁴%%~~~~~~~~",
"|,,,ê,,,,,|⁴⁴⁴%~~~~~~~~~",
"|||||,,||||⁴⁴⁴%~~~~~~~~~",
Expand All @@ -260,14 +259,14 @@
"|||||,,||||⁴⁴⁴%~~~~~~~~~",
"|,,,ê,,,,,|⁴⁴⁴%~~~~~~~~~",
"|,,,,,,,,,|⁴⁴⁴%%~~~~~~~~",
"|,,,,,,,,,|⁴⁴⁴%%~~~~~~~",
"|,,,,,,,,,|⁴é⁴⁴%%~~~~~~~",
"|,,,,,,,,,|⁴⁴⁴⁴⁴%%~~~~~~",
"|,,,,ê,,,,|ƶ=|||⁴%%~~~~~",
"|,,,,,,,,,|``|>|⁴⁴%%~~~~",
"|,,,,,,,,,|``|#||⁴⁴%%~~~",
"|,,,,,,,,,|`````|⁴⁴%%%%",
"|,,,,,,,,,|`````|é⁴⁴%%%%",
"|,,,,,,,,,=``î`<|⁴⁴⁴⁴⁴⁴⁴",
"|,,,,,,,,,ƶ`````|⁴⁴⁴⁴⁴⁴"
"|,,,,,,,,,ƶ`````|⁴⁴⁴⁴⁴⁴é"
],
"palettes": [ "lab_common_palette", "lab_security_palette" ],
"place_monsters": [ { "monster": "GROUP_LAB_BASIC_SECURITY", "x": [ 1, 8 ], "y": [ 1, 22 ], "density": 0.1 } ],
Expand Down Expand Up @@ -312,7 +311,10 @@
"|,,,,,,,|;|``````````|;|"
],
"palettes": [ "lab_common_palette", "lab_security_palette" ],
"place_loot": [ { "item": "id_science_maintenance_green", "x": 1, "y": 8, "chance": 25 } ],
"place_loot": [
{ "item": "id_science_maintenance_green", "x": 1, "y": 8, "chance": 25 },
{ "item": "hacksaw", "x": 1, "y": [ 14, 15 ], "chance": 100 }
],
"terrain": { "¥": "t_card_science_security_yellow", "ƶ": "t_card_science_security_magenta" },
"place_signs": [
{ "signage": "<color_white_red>Badges Mandatory Beyond This Point.</color>", "x": 10, "y": 10 },
Expand Down
26 changes: 13 additions & 13 deletions data/json/mapgen/lab/lab_modular/lab_central_hallway.json
Original file line number Diff line number Diff line change
Expand Up @@ -8,13 +8,13 @@
"object": {
"fill_ter": "t_linoleum_white",
"rows": [
";;;;;;;;;;;;;;;;;;X...y..y...X;;;;;;;;;;;;;;;;;;",
"; ;;;;;;;;;;;;;;;;XX........XX;;;;;;;;;;;;;;;; ;",
"%%%%%%%%%%%%%%%%;;;XX......XX;;;%%%%%%%%%%%%%%%%",
"~~~~~~~~~~~~~~~%%;;;XX....XX;;;%%~~~~~~~~~~~~~~~",
"~~~~~~~~~~~~~~~~%;;;;XXXXXX;;;;%~~~~~~~~~~~~~~~~",
";;;;;;;é;;;;;;;;é;:...y..y...:;é;;;;;;;;é;;;;;;;",
"; ;;;;;;;;;;;;;;;;::........::;;;;;;;;;;;;;;;; ;",
"%%%%%%%%%%%%%%%%;;;::......::;;;%%%%%%%%%%%%%%%%",
"~~~~~~~~~~~~~~~%%;;;::....::;;;%%~~~~~~~~~~~~~~~",
"~~~~~~~~~~~~~~~~%;;;;::::::;;;;%~~~~~~~~~~~~~~~~",
"~~~~~~~~~~~~~~~~%%;;;;;;;;;;;;%%~~~~~~~~~~~~~~~~",
"~~~~~~~~~~~~~~~~~%%%;;;;;;;;%%%~~~~~~~~~~~~~~~~~",
"~~~~~~~~~~~~~~~~~%%%;;;;é;;;%%%~~~~~~~~~~~~~~~~~",
"~~~~~~~~~~~~~~~~~~ %%%%%%%%%% ~~~~~~~~~~~~~~~~~~",
"~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~",
"~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~",
Expand All @@ -25,15 +25,15 @@
"~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~",
"~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~",
"~~~~~~~~~~~~~~~~~~ %%%%%%%%%% ~~~~~~~~~~~~~~~~~~",
"~~~~~~~~~~~~~~~~~%%%;;;;;;;;%%%~~~~~~~~~~~~~~~~~",
"~~~~~~~~~~~~~~~~~%%%;;;;é;;;%%%~~~~~~~~~~~~~~~~~",
"~~~~~~~~~~~~~~~~%%;;;;;;;;;;;;%%~~~~~~~~~~~~~~~~",
"~~~~~~~~~~~~~~~~%;;;;XXXXXX;;;;%~~~~~~~~~~~~~~~~",
"~~~~~~~~~~~~~~~%%;;;XX....XX;;;%%~~~~~~~~~~~~~~~",
"%%%%%%%%%%%%%%%%;;;XX......XX;;;%%%%%%%%%%%%%%%%",
"; ;;;;;;;;;;;;;;;;XX........XX;;;;;;;;;;;;;;;; ;",
";;;;;;;;;;;;;;;;;;X...y..y...X;;;;;;;;;;;;;;;;;;"
"~~~~~~~~~~~~~~~~%;;;;::::::;;;;%~~~~~~~~~~~~~~~~",
"~~~~~~~~~~~~~~~%%;;;::....::;;;%%~~~~~~~~~~~~~~~",
"%%%%%%%%%%%%%%%%;;;::......::;;;%%%%%%%%%%%%%%%%",
"; ;;;;;;;;;;;;;;;;::........::;;;;;;;;;;;;;;;; ;",
";;;;;;;é;;;;;;;;é;:...y..y...:;é;;;;;;;;é;;;;;;;"
],
"palettes": [ "lab_common_palette", "lab_residential_palette" ],
"palettes": [ "lab_common_palette" ],
"terrain": { " ": "t_strconc_floor" },
"monster": { " ": { "monster": "mon_turret_searchlight" } },
"place_monster": [
Expand Down
18 changes: 9 additions & 9 deletions data/json/mapgen/lab/lab_modular/lab_health_clinic.json
Original file line number Diff line number Diff line change
Expand Up @@ -7,30 +7,30 @@
"object": {
"fill_ter": "t_linoleum_white",
"rows": [
";;;;;;;;;;;;;|||||||||||",
";é;;;;;;;;;;;|||||||||||",
";;;;;;;;;;;;;|.........|",
"%%%%;;;;;;;;;|.........|",
"%%%%;;;;é;;;;|.........|",
"~~~%%;;;;;;;;|.........|",
"~~~~%%;;;;;;;|....ë....|",
"~~~~~%%;;;;;;|.........|",
"~~~~~~%%;;;;;|.........|",
"~~~~~~~%%;;;;|.........|",
"~~~~~~~~%%;;;Xj........#",
"~~~~~~~~~%;;;Xj...ë....#",
"~~~~~~~~%%;;;:j........#",
"~~~~~~~~~%;;;:j...ë....#",
"~~~~~~~~~%;;;|||||--||||",
"~~~~~~~~~%;;;|221...|.>|",
"~~~~~~~~~%;;;|22-...-.>|",
"~~~~~~~~~%;é;|22-...-.>|",
"~~~~~~~~~%;;;|||||--||||",
"~~~~~~~~~%;;;Xj...ë....#",
"~~~~~~~~%%;;;Xj........#",
"~~~~~~~~~%;;;:j...ë....#",
"~~~~~~~~%%;;;:j........#",
"~~~~~~~%%;;;;|.........|",
"~~~~~~%%;;;;;|.........|",
"~~~~~%%;;;;;;|.........|",
"~~~~%%;;;;;;;|....ë....|",
"~~~%%;;;;;;;;|.........|",
"%%%%;;;;;;;;;|.........|",
"%%%%;;;;é;;;;|.........|",
";;;;;;;;;;;;;|.........|",
";;;;;;;;;;;;;|||||||||||"
";é;;;;;;;;;;;|||||||||||"
],
"palettes": [ "lab_common_palette", "lab_medical_palette" ],
"place_nested": [
Expand Down
6 changes: 5 additions & 1 deletion data/json/mapgen_palettes/lab/lab_modular_palette.json
Original file line number Diff line number Diff line change
Expand Up @@ -326,7 +326,11 @@
"items": {
"3": { "item": "vending_food", "chance": 90 },
"4": { "item": "vending_drink", "chance": 90 },
"U": [ { "item": "home_hw", "chance": 10, "repeat": [ 1, 2 ] }, { "item": "cleaning", "chance": 40, "repeat": [ 1, 2 ] } ],
"U": [
{ "item": "home_hw", "chance": 10, "repeat": [ 1, 2 ] },
{ "item": "drugs_emergency", "chance": 30, "repeat": [ 1, 2 ] },
{ "item": "cleaning", "chance": 40, "repeat": [ 1, 2 ] }
],
"∞": [
{ "item": "clothing_soldier_set", "chance": 100 },
{ "item": "gear_soldier_sidearm", "chance": 33 },
Expand Down
9 changes: 4 additions & 5 deletions data/json/monstergroups/lab.json
Original file line number Diff line number Diff line change
Expand Up @@ -204,17 +204,16 @@
"name": "GROUP_LAB_BASIC_SECURITY",
"default": "mon_zombie_labsecurity",
"monsters": [
{ "monster": "mon_feral_labsecurity_9mm", "freq": 18, "cost_multiplier": 8 },
{ "monster": "mon_feral_labsecurity_flashlight", "freq": 18, "cost_multiplier": 2 },
{ "monster": "mon_feral_labsecurity_9mm", "freq": 18, "cost_multiplier": 12 },
{ "monster": "mon_feral_labsecurity_flashlight", "freq": 18, "cost_multiplier": 2, "pack_size": [ 1, 2 ] },
{ "monster": "mon_zombie_labsecurity", "freq": 40, "cost_multiplier": 0, "pack_size": [ 2, 3 ] },
{ "monster": "mon_zombie_hazmat", "freq": 10, "cost_multiplier": 1, "pack_size": [ 1, 2 ] },
{ "monster": "mon_zombie", "freq": 30, "cost_multiplier": 1, "pack_size": [ 2, 4 ] },
{ "monster": "mon_zombie_fat", "freq": 20, "cost_multiplier": 1, "pack_size": [ 1, 2 ] },
{ "monster": "mon_zombie_tough", "freq": 20, "cost_multiplier": 2 },
{ "monster": "mon_zombie_crawler", "freq": 10, "cost_multiplier": 1 },
{ "monster": "mon_zombie_technician", "freq": 3, "cost_multiplier": 2 },
{ "monster": "mon_zombie_necro", "freq": 1, "cost_multiplier": 15 },
{ "monster": "mon_eyebot", "freq": 10, "cost_multiplier": 10 }
{ "monster": "mon_zombie_technician", "freq": 3, "cost_multiplier": 5 },
{ "monster": "mon_zombie_necro", "freq": 1, "cost_multiplier": 15 }
]
},
{
Expand Down

0 comments on commit 0447a46

Please sign in to comment.